The Role

As an MOT Tester / Vehicle Technician, you will:

  • Carry out Class 4 MOT tests in line with DVSA regulations
  • Complete MOT documentation accurately
  • Identify vehicle faults and safety‑related defects
  • Carry out vehicle servicing, maintenance and repairs
  • Diagnose mechanical and electrical faults
  • Conduct vehicle inspections and health checks
  • Maintain high workshop and safety standards
  • Deliver excellent customer service
  • Work independently and as part of a professional team

Requirements

  • Valid Class 4 MOT Tester Licence
  • NVQ Level 3 in Light Vehicle Maintenance & Repair (or equivalent preferred)
  • Previous experience as an MOT Tester, Vehicle Technician, Automotive Technician, Diagnostic Technician or Mechanic
  • Strong diagnostic and fault‑finding skills
  • Good mechanical and electrical knowledge
  • Full UK Driving Licence
  • Reliable, professional and team‑focused approach
